• 技术文章 >web前端 >css教程

    css3的弹性盒怎么做出来

    php中世界最好的语言php中世界最好的语言2017-11-24 11:52:41原创1136
    有时候我们需要在CSS3里写一个弹性盒子,那么这个代码怎么做出来呢?这就需要用到我们的box-shadow属性了,他可以让盒子在显示的时候产生阴影效果,下面就给大家详细的说明一下

    写法:

    box-shadow:length length length color;

    第一个参数表示阴影离开盒子的横向距离

    第二个参数表示阴影离开盒子的纵向距离

    第三个参数表示阴影的模糊半径

    第四个参数表示阴影的颜色

    对盒子内元素使用阴影

    可以单独对盒子内的子元素使用阴影。

    可以使用first-letter选择器或者first-line选择器来只让第一个文字或者第一行具有

    阴影效果

    表格及单元格使用阴影

    可以使用box-shadow属性让表格及表格内的单元格产生阴影效果。

    指定针对元素的宽度与高度的计算方法

    在css3中,使用box-sizing属性来指定针对元素的宽度与高度的计算方法

    box-sizing属性

    在css中,使用width属性和height属性来指定元素的宽度和高度。

    但是使用box-sizing属性,可以指定用width属性和height属性分别指定的宽度和

    高度值是否包含元素内部的补白区域,以及边框的宽度和高度。

    可以给box-sizing属性指定的属性值为content-box属性值与border-box属性值。前者表示元素的宽度与高度不包括内部补白区域,以及边框的宽度与高度

    ,后者表示元素的宽度与高度包括内部补白区域,以及边框的宽度与高度。

    以前默认的是使用content-box属性值。

    另外,可以在box-sizing属性中指定属

    性值为padding-box,即指定的宽度与

    高度内容包括内容的宽度与高度和内

    部补白区域的宽度和高度,不包括边

    框的宽度与高度

    使用的目的是控制元素的总宽度,如果不使用该属性,样式中默认的使用的

    是content-box属性值,它只针对内容的宽度做了一个指定,却没有对元素的

    总宽度进行指定。

    有些场合下利用border-box属性值会使得页面布局更加方便。

    例,只要将两个div元素的border-box属性值都设定为50%,就可以确保两个div

    元素并列显示了。

    这就是弹性盒的做法了,更多精彩请关注php中文网其它相关文章!

    相关阅读:

    html里怎么插入图片

    html里div居中需要注意哪些

    html里的if注释怎么使用

    以上就是css3的弹性盒怎么做出来的详细内容,更多请关注php中文网其它相关文章!

    声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n核实处理。
    专题推荐:css3 样式表 css
    上一篇:在HTML里web标准是什么 下一篇:怎么用CSS3媒体查询

    相关文章推荐

    • 鲜为人知!用css做极光效果• 你了解 Transition 吗?一起来深入了解下Transition!• 浅析CSS中的5种设计模式,聊聊vue项目中CSS目录代码的作用• 手把手教你CSS架构之SMACSS• 深入浅析css中的层叠上下文

    全部评论我要评论

  • 取消发布评论发送
  • 1/1

    PHP中文网